ABSTRACT
The Street Light System with Solar Panel Sensor is a sensitive device with great efficiency of photo detection. In this work, I used a solar panel, 12V battery, comparator, relay, LED and other components like resistor, transistors etc. This work is made up of five units: Solar panel, Battery charging unit where I used the Timer known as LM741 and LM317 which stabilize the volts entering the circuit; The battery unit where the battery is being charged. The comparator unit where the two input signals from the battery and the solar panel are compared. At a volt below zero the comparator takes it as zero and there will be no switching but at one volt and above, there will be switching which leads us to the switching unit were the relay does the switching. At the lighting unit, the LEDs turns ON and OFF at DUSK, and DAWN respectively. This work was tested for three days and was observed that as at 6:30pm the light turns ON and OFF at 6:00am.
